Cholera diagnosis in human stool and detection in water: protocol for a systematic review of available technologies
BACKGROUND: Cholera is a highly infectious diarrheal disease spread via fecal contamination of water and food sources; it is endemic in parts of Africa and Asia and recent outbreaks have been reported in Haiti, the Zambia and Democratic Republic of the Congo.
